The ELA Item Writer II develops high-quality assessment content focused on reading and literacy for K-12 learners.
This role combines English Language Arts expertise with assessment design, creativity, and analytical thinking.
You will collaborate with interdisciplinary teams to create test items, passages, performance tasks, and interactive assessment experiences.
The position offers the opportunity to contribute to large-scale standardized assessments used across diverse educational settings.
You will help ensure that assessment content is accurate, engaging, accessible, and aligned with defined learning objectives.
The role also provides exposure to assessment development, content review, item management, and evolving educational technologies.

Accountabilities
Develop passages, test questions, performance tasks, and other assessment content designed to measure student learning in reading and literacy.
Work collaboratively with interdisciplinary teams to develop high-quality, standards-aligned assessment materials.
Research and identify appropriate stimulus materials for assessments and obtain copyright permissions when required.
Create and review assessment items using specialized digital tools, including interactive items, simulations, and other technology-enhanced tasks.
Participate in individual and group item review sessions, incorporating feedback and documenting revisions accurately.
Assist with the assembly and review of field-test and operational assessment forms.
Contribute to ancillary assessment materials, including interpretive guides, score reports, item release websites, and related resources.
Support senior team members with the management of item banks and the development of new assessments, products, and services.
Contribute to the development and refinement of assessment specifications.
Identify potential issues in assessment content and propose practical, well-reasoned solutions.
Manage competing priorities effectively while meeting project deadlines and maintaining a high standard of accuracy and quality.
Travel approximately 1-6 times per year for required meetings or project activities, typically for 2-3 days at a time, including potential travel during the summer months.
